Francesco Bagnaia spoke clearly Francesco Bagnaia on the eve of what for him is the home race par excellence, at Misano. The Ducati champion, in his last San Marino GP with the red suit before moving to Aprilia next year, did not hesitate to reiterate once again his thoughts on the technical turning point undertaken by the Borgo Panigale factory in the last two years, precisely when #63 began to face an evident crisis of results that is still ongoing.

Speaking with journalists present at the Romagna circuit, Bagnaia – as reported by the site Motorsport.com – pronounced words destined to spark debate: “I think the potential that the Ducatis had with the GP24 was unbeatable – said Bagnaia, who in that season won 11 GPs but lost the title to then teammate Jorge Martin, as recently recalled also by Gigi Dall’Ignaeven today, if we were four GP24s, we would be the top four in the World Championship. I remember very well this race from three years ago and the potential we had. The Aprilias have improved, but the Ducatis have also taken a step back. So, maybe, if this weekend we manage to find something, we can fight with them. Otherwise, the Aprilias could be very strong“.

Updates and ‘aging’

Bagnaia then also seemed skeptical about the usefulness for Ducati to ‘evolve’ the GP26 with updated components: “I am quite convinced that we don’t need new things – commented the Piedmontese rider – I am convinced that we need old things. But the bike is this and other riders manage to be fast. So it’s my problem and I have to adapt“, he concluded. Ducati’s hope is that Bagnaia returns to being fast in this final part of the season, also because his resurgence could be useful in the perspective of taking points away from the Aprilias of Martin and Bezzecchi and indirectly helping Marc Marquez’s comeback. Certainly, if even at Misano the Italian’s feeling with the GP26 were disastrous, it would be hard to imagine on which other circuit things could improve before the end of the championship.
